Jobs for Religious Studies Grads in Tennessee
In this state, there are 590 people employed in jobs related to a Religion degree, compared to 32,270 nationwide.
Wages for Religious Studies Jobs in Tennessee
In this state, Religion grads earn an average of $75,020. Nationwide, they make an average of $91,447.

Religious Studies Careers in TN
Some of the careers Religion majors go into include:
| Job Title | Nationwide Job Growth | Nationwide Median Salary |
|---|---|---|
| Area, Ethnic, and Cultural Studies Teachers, Postsecondary | 7% | $47,517 |
| Philosophy and Religion Teachers, Postsecondary | 4% | $71,584 |
